Balancing Growth And Equity: An Evaluation of Foreign Direct Investment Policies in Papua in 2023

Abstract

Development that focuses solely on economic growth without considering equity can trigger injustice and worsen inequality. Therefore, it is necessary to implement policies that not only drive economic growth but also ensure a more equitable distribution. This study aims to analyze the level of economic inequality during the 2018–2022 period and to evaluate the design of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) policies in Papua Province in 2023. The research employs a descriptive quantitative approach, utilizing the Williamson Index to measure the degree of inequality and Input-Output analysis to evaluate FDI policies in Papua. Based on the Williamson Index calculations for the 2018–2022 period, the average level of economic inequality in Papua reached 1.52, which falls into the category of very high inequality. The results of sectoral prioritization mapping through Input-Output analysis indicate that the Electricity and Gas Supply sector, as well as the Information and Communication sector, have output and labor multipliers above the average of all sectors. Thus, these two sectors can serve as strategic focuses in the formulation of investment policies aimed at promoting more inclusive and sustainable economic growth in Papua.
